Guti returns to Crosstown Rebels with improvisational new EP 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’.

A new wave of Latin-infused groove arrives on Crosstown Rebels, and South American favourite Guti is at the helm. Returning to Damian Lazarus’ imprint with a release that captures his music in its most immediate and expressive form, his four-track 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’ EP marks his first material on the label since 2020, reigniting a relationship that stretches back over 15 years. For the Argentinian artist, the studio has always been a living room, a jam space, a place where ideas can breathe, collide, and evolve naturally. Throughout his career, Guti has blended groove-driven house and Latin percussion into a signature sonic language in which spontaneity guides the process. The result here is a new release that feels as alive as it does intentional, designed for ears, hearts, and dancefloors alike.

“This EP came together very naturally. It was more about capturing a moment, a feeling, and letting the music breathe. Improvisation plays a huge role in how I work, moving towards whatever new ways the music shows me. 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’ is really about trusting that instinct and letting groove and emotion lead the way. These tracks are made for the dancefloor; they’re also about feeling, about movement, tension, release, and connection. I wanted the EP to sound organic and human, like it does when I jam in the studio. 

Coming back to Crosstown Rebels felt very natural. There’s a shared understanding of music, on taking risks and looking for fresh sounds and ideas. A new language that’s expressive, emotional. 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’ feels like a continuation of a long conversation with the label and myself, one that’s evolved over time, but is still rooted in freedom and rhythm.” – Guti.

Title track 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’ opens with warm rhythmic layers and subtle instrumental interplay, a space where melody and movement coexist freely. ‘What You Give’ follows, pulsing with the organic energy of jam-session dynamics, each percussive gesture and melodic line alive with intention. On the flip, ‘The Truth’ unfurls a rich tapestry of percussion, soulful vocals, and improvisational motifs, while ‘La Nueva Onda Latina’ closes the EP as a vivid statement; an embodiment of the “new Latin sound” at the heart of Guti’s ethos, where instruments, electronics, and collaborative energy meet on equal footing.

At its core, 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’ is a showcase of a musical mind at work: deliberate yet free, precise yet flowing, rooted in tradition but open to the unexpected. It’s a reflection of Guti’s belief that dance music can be both kinetic and expressive, that improvisation and groove can coexist, and that the most resonant sounds are born when musicians let go in the moment. This EP invites listeners into that space, to move with the rhythms, and to experience a sound unmistakably Guti; organic, vibrant, and alive.

Guti ‘You Know Ya Miss Me’ drops via Crosstown Rebels on 13th March 2026.
